Update a Parent Case with an attachment made in the last comment of a subtask

I have created a rule that captures the last comment made in a subtask when the subtask transitions to Further Information Required. The subtask comment is always updated when this transition occurs, and the automation adds that comment to the Parent case.

What I am trying to ensure is that, should that subtask's comment also contain an attachment, that too is copied across to the Parent case.

What I do NOT want is any attachment from the subtask that is NOT associated with the transitional comment mentioned above. In other words, simply adding the Last attachment may not work if the last attachment was made before the transition.

Thinking on the fly here.

What if...
I could get the timestamp of the last comment (the one created as part of the transition) and the timestamp of the last attachment and then...

If they match (within a few seconds) the chance is, they're connected ad i can then proceed to add the last attachment to the Parent case?

I have made some progress in that I can pull the DateTime dtails for all attachments in the subtask and accepting a 10 second variance, identify an attachment that has very recently been added.
The question now is how to actually copy that latest attachment to the Parent without copying all attachments. Now I'm stuck
